FAQ: How do I restore the Agrilink gateway config?

If a release rollback leaves the Agrilink farm-equipment telemetry gateway with a corrupted configuration, do not re-flash the unit. Instead, boot into maintenance mode and run the config-restore wizard, which pulls the last known-good snapshot. The wizard will prompt you for the recovery passphrase, which is provided below.

unlock words, hahip-yagef: zorok-novmir-zorix-silax

// Bulk-edit client for the Marigold admin table.
// This wires up the batch endpoint so ops can update up to 500 rows
// in one shot instead of hammering the single-row API. Heads up for
// release: batches are NOT transactional yet — partial failures get
// logged to the dead-letter queue, so check it after big edits.
// Rate limit is 10 batches/min; the client backs off automatically.
// Auth against the Marigold internal gateway uses the key below.

app token of yajeg-kawef = kto11_7En3XSX8xQw

Hey — before you can review my branch, heads up: the Brimworth secrets vault that holds the QueueLift scaling tokens locked itself again after the cert rotation. The autoscaler reads queue-depth metrics from Pondermill, and without the vault open, the integration tests just hang, so don't blame your review env. I already pinged the platform folks; they said any reviewer can unseal it themselves. Pop open the vault CLI, pick the QueueLift realm, and paste in the recovery passphrase below.

vault phrase of tagaf-hawef = jordor-wenok-gorael-wenion-keleth-sorion-wenys-novix-fenir-fraax-fenael-aldius-fraok

Welcome to the Gristmill validator plugin API! Your plugin gets a record, returns a verdict, and Gristmill handles batching, retries, and timeouts — you don't. One catch: plugins that exceed the budget get benched for a cooldown, so keep your validators snappy. The runtime enforces the budget using a few shared constants, which we've listed below for easy reference.

tuning table, yajog-yahof:
BUDGETS = {
    "lamvan": 303,
    "wenox": 460,
    "fenvan": 525,
}